Question: Do you think children should learn to play musical instruments?
Enhances cognitive development and improves memory
Boosts creativity and self-expression
Teaches discipline and patience through practice
Provides a sense of achievement and boosts confidence
Encourages teamwork when playing in bands or orchestras
Offers a productive way to spend leisure time
Can be expensive due to instrument costs and lessons
Might distract from academic studies
Not all children are interested in music
Some children may feel pressured and lose interest
Limited time for other extracurricular activities
Parents may not have the resources to support this hobby
Depends on the child's interest and passion for music
Some children may benefit more from other activities
Schools can offer optional music classes for interested students
Parents should consider the child's schedule and commitments
Music can be introduced as a hobby rather than a mandatory skill
